Franklin Mills funds distributed to area groups

On June 9, the Franklin Mills Advisory Council distributed $89,725 to more than 25 community organizations in an award ceremony at the Northeast Senior Center, 12601 Townsend Road.

Among the 2014 beneficiaries are Academy Sports Association, an all-volunteer staff dedicated to providing youth sporting programs to promote mental and physical health; City of Philadelphia Fire Department Ladder 31; Philadelphia Police Department 8th District; Far Northeast Senior Citizens Center; and Parkwood Youth Organization.

Funded by Simon, owner of Franklin Mills mall, the Franklin Mills Advisory Council has been supporting area youth sports groups, seni-or cit-izens, schools, churches, po-lice and fire and oth-er char-it-able or-gan-iz-a-tions since 1989.

The Council comprises representatives of neighborhood groups primarily located in the Northeast section of Philadelphia. Since its inception, the FMAC has donated more than $2 million to community improvement organizations in the area. ••
